Pyramids of Giza
Pyramids of Giza

The Pyramids of Giza consist of the Great Pyramid of Khufu, the Pyramid of Khafre, and the Pyramid of Menkaure. The site also features the famous Great Sphinx, a massive statue with the body of a lion and the head of a pharaoh.

Old Coptic Cairo
Old Coptic Cairo

Old Coptic Cairo is a historic area in Cairo, home to several ancient Christian churches, including the Hanging Church and St. Sergius and Bacchus Church. It also contains the Coptic Museum, showcasing Egypt's Christian heritage.

The Alabaster Mosque and The Citadel
The Alabaster Mosque and The Citadel

The Alabaster Mosque, located in the Citadel of Saladin, is famous for its striking alabaster walls. The Citadel offers panoramic views of Cairo and hosts several important museums.

The Queen Hatshepsut Temple
The Queen Hatshepsut Temple

The Temple of Queen Hatshepsut is an architectural masterpiece, carved into the cliffs of Deir el-Bahari, showcasing elegant terraces and honoring Egypt’s most powerful female pharaoh.

Day 3: Activity - 3
Memnon Colossi Statues
Memnon Colossi Statues

You will be transported to the Memnon Colossi visit: We'll then view the Memnon statues. They are the sole extant sculptures fronting the mortuary temple of Amenhotep III, showing the pharaoh seated on his throne.

Temple of Ramses the great
Temple of Ramses the great

The Temple of Ramses the Great at Abu Simbel is a massive rock-cut temple built by Pharaoh Ramses II, featuring four giant statues of the king and dedicated to the gods Amun, Ra-Horakhty, and Ptah.

Day 4: Activity - 2
Temple of Queen Nefertari
Temple of Queen Nefertari

The Temple of Queen Nefertari, located near the Great Temple of Ramses II at Abu Simbel, is dedicated to the goddess Hathor. It features stunning carvings of Nefertari and Ramses II, symbolizing the queen's importance and her divine connection.

The Catacombs
The Catacombs

We begin at the Catacombs, which feature a blend of Greek, Roman, and Egyptian art across three levels. The main tomb is adorned with symbols, statues, and carvings from these ancient cultures.

Day 5: Activity - 2
The Seraphim Temple
The Seraphim Temple

Next, visit Pompey's Pillar, a 25-meter-tall red granite structure from the 3rd century. Erected in honor of Emperor Diocletian, it is one of the few remaining parts of the Seraphim Temple and once rivaled the grandeur of the Soma and Cesarean.

Day 5: Activity - 3
Qaitbay Citadel
Qaitbay Citadel

Next, visit the Qaitbay Citadel, built by Sultan Qaitbay on the site of the ancient Alexandria Lighthouse, which was destroyed by an earthquake. Your guide will explain the military history and significance of the citadel and the lighthouse.During your tour of Qaitbay Citadel, your tour guide will tell you more about the military monuments and the Lighthouse of Alexandria.
